Guy Ritchie's recent Sherlock Holmes film has been accused by many as being steampunk. You think? The movie critics oddly missed the 'other' Sherlock Holmes film of the time - which has dinosaurs, steam droids, and evil monsters.
![]()
Now that's what I call steampunk!
